Vessel rams Philippine fishing boat, Vietnamese ship recovers five fishermen

2025/2/21 英字

A vessel rammed a Philippine wooden fishing boat at vicinity of waters off Spratly Islands in the evening of January 30, with a Vietnamese cargo ship recovering five last February 16 in the waters of Vietnam, the Philippine Coast Guard (PCG) said Thursday.

Three others from the fishing vessel Prince Elmo 2 are missing and the Philippine Coast Guard (PCG) are trying to find them.

In a PCG statement, BRP Boracay "has aided the five fishermen onboard of FBCA Prince Elmo 2 in the vicinity off Corregidor Island yesterday, 19 February 2025".

The rescued fishermen were brought on Wednesday morning to the Coast Guard Sub-station Naic in Cavite and Municipal Disaster Risk Reduction and Management Office (MDRRMO) Naic.

MV Dong An rescued the five fishermen at 3:15 pm on February 16 in the waters off Vietnam, PCG said. The Vietnamese cargo vessel searched the area for the three missing fishermen but saw no signs of them.

Senator Francis Tolentino, who chairs the committee condemned the incident.

"I hope our authorities can find them. I also support the efforts of the PCG to track down the culprit, and for the government to take appropriate actions," Tolentino added. Marie Manalili/DMS
